LEXINGTON, Ky. (FOX 56) — Expect more clouds than sunshine across the state today with showers and storms developing during the afternoon and evening.

It will be warm and breezy with highs in the 70s, possibly hitting 80 in a spot or two in eastern Kentucky.

A cold front sweeps through Tonight into the wee hours of Saturday morning bringing the best chance for rain. By sunrise, the widespread rain should be out of the area.

It will be a much cooler day with highs in the upper 50s and lower 60s. Partly sunny to mostly cloudy conditions continue into the afternoon with scattered showers possible.

A general 1/2 inch to 3/4 inch of rain is possible by the time the rain wraps up on Saturday.

Clouds should break-up Saturday night allowing temperatures to fall into the 30s with areas of frost possible. A better chance for frost and a freeze comes Sunday night into Monday.
